‎Super Eagles Star Uche Claims Prestigious Baller of The Week Award

In a weekend where Nigerian talent shone brightly across Europe’s premier leagues, Christantus Uche showcased a standout performance that overshadowed more prominent stars, earning him the accolade of Baller of the Week.

‎The 22-year-old Uche played a pivotal role in Getafe’s crucial away victory against Celta Vigo in La Liga. The emerging Super Eagles midfielder contributed to both goals, first providing the assist for Liso to score, and then securing the win with his own goal 18 minutes before the final whistle.

‎This performance highlighted Uche’s immediate impact in Spain’s top division and marked his first goal of the season, indicating a promising trajectory for a player still in the early stages of his European journey.

‎The weekend’s matches also featured several impressive performances from Nigerian players, as noted by Pulse Sports. Victor Osimhen, making a notable return to Galatasaray, started on the bench and was unable to score after coming on as a substitute in a 1-0 win over Karagümrük.

‎Wilfred Ndidi of Besiktas also made a strong debut after his transfer from Leicester City, effectively controlling the midfield in a 2-1 victory against Eyüpspor.

‎However, it was Uche’s dual impact, with a sharp assist and a goal, that drew the most attention and defined the weekend for Nigerian talent abroad.

‎He created three chances, delivered two key passes, scored with his only shot on target from two attempts, made four recoveries, won nine duels, and executed one tackle.

‎His performance was instrumental in helping Getafe secure vital three points and solidified his reputation as one of the most promising young talents in Europe’s elite leagues.
